Product Name: External Dynamic Braking Resistor (Regen Resistor) Unit
-
Product Introduction: A regenerative (shunt) resistor designed to dissipate kinetic energy returned to the DC bus during motor deceleration or overhauling loads, preventing over-voltage faults in the servo drive.

Working Principle: When DC bus voltage exceeds a preset threshold (e.g., 380V-400V in 240V drives), the drive switches the resistor across the bus to convert electrical energy into heat, clamping the bus voltage.

Material & Structural Features:
-
Element: Wirewound resistive alloy on ceramic core.
-
Housing: Often aluminum extrusion with fins for convection, or enclosed metal box with terminals.
-
Connections: Screw terminals for high-current cabling.

Installation & Notes:
-
Sizing Critical: Must be calculated via Motioneering software or manual calc (Energy = I²Rt). Undersized resistors will overheat.
-
Location: Install in a well-ventilated area away from heat-sensitive components; do not enclose without forced cooling if running high duty.
-
Cabling: Use appropriately sized cables (typically same gauge as drive power input or per manual) and route separately from low-voltage signal wires.
